1.3. USE LIMITATIONS. CONTRAINDICATIONS
The tests must be interpreted by a doctor, and only a doctor can indicate the treatment to be applied. The health professional must
take into account the patient's symptoms before performing an audiometric test. The acceptability of a test is the responsibility of
the health professional. The audiometer must not be used when the validity of the results might be compromised by external factors.
Audiometry tests require the patient's cooperation; the patient needs to press a warning button when they detect stimuli.
The doctor needs to assess the patient's ability to undergo the audiometry test. Special attention must be paid to children,
elderly people, and disable patients.
The EN ISO 8253-1 standard specifies certain requirements on the environmental noise conditions when performing audiometric
tests. It is recommended to install the audiometer with a soundproof booth for the audiometric tests, or to adapt noise-canceling
devises in the headphones, so that the validity of the results is not compromised. Please, refer to the booth user manual to connect
the audiometer, or to the instructions for the noise canceling device.
